Key Skills to Look For
Technical Skills
A mechanical technician in Kuwait Al Ahmadi should have a strong foundation in mechanical principles, including knowledge of mechanical systems, thermodynamics, and materials science.
Troubleshooting Abilities
The ability to diagnose and repair complex mechanical issues is crucial. Look for technicians with experience in troubleshooting and problem-solving.
Familiarity with Tools and Equipment
Proficiency in using various tools and equipment, such as multimeters, oscilloscopes, and mechanical testing equipment, is essential.
Soft Skills
Good communication and teamwork skills are vital for effective collaboration with other teams and stakeholders.
Industry Exposure
Experience working in industries relevant to your project, such as oil and gas, manufacturing, or construction, can be beneficial.
Certifications and Qualifications
Relevant certifications, such as CMRP or CMRT, can demonstrate a technician's expertise and commitment to their profession.
Computer-Aided Design (CAD) Skills
Proficiency in CAD software can be an asset for mechanical technicians, especially for projects involving design and development.
Analytical Skills
The ability to analyze data, identify patterns, and make informed decisions is critical for mechanical technicians.
Screening & Interviewing Process
Initial Screening
Begin by reviewing resumes and cover letters to assess qualifications and experience.
Technical Assessments
Conduct technical assessments or tests to evaluate a candidate's skills and knowledge.
Sample Interview Questions for Mechanical Technician
- What experience do you have with mechanical systems?
- How do you approach troubleshooting complex mechanical issues?
- Can you describe a challenging project you worked on and your role in it?
- How do you stay updated with the latest technologies and trends?
- Can you give an example of a time when you had to work under pressure to meet a deadline?
- How do you handle conflicting priorities and multiple tasks?
Reference Checks
Verify a candidate's previous work experience and performance by conducting reference checks.
